Market Context

IES Holdings has recently traded near the upper end of its range, hovering close to the $686 level after a modest weekly gain of about 1.3%. Volume has been somewhat elevated relative to the 50-day average, suggesting increased investor attention without signaling overextension. The stock appears to be consolidating just below the $720 resistance zone, with near-term support holding around $652. Momentum indicators lean slightly bullish, though the relative strength index is in the mid-50s, leaving room for further upside without immediate overbought concerns. Sector-wise, IESC continues to benefit from tailwinds in the electrical infrastructure and data center construction space. Market participants have been rotating toward companies with exposure to large-scale electrification projects and onshoring trends, which may be providing a fundamental underpinning for recent price action. The broader industrials segment has shown mixed performance this month, but IESC's niche focus on complex commercial and industrial installations appears to be a differentiator. Drivers behind recent trading include ongoing demand for mission-critical facilities and rebuilding initiatives across the U.S. While the stock has seen periodic profit-taking near the resistance level, buyers have stepped in on dips, keeping the pattern constructive. Traders are monitoring whether a clear breakout above $720 can occur in the coming sessions, as that would likely confirm the next leg higher. Technical Analysis

IESC shares have been trading in a defined range recently, with price action consolidating between the support level of $652.29 and resistance near $720.95. The current price of $686.62 sits near the midpoint of this channel, suggesting the market is in a period of indecision. The stock has tested the support zone on multiple occasions over the past several weeks, each time bouncing higher, which may indicate that buyers are stepping in around that area. Conversely, resistance at $720.95 has capped upside moves, with sellers emerging near that threshold. From a trend perspective, IESC appears to be forming a potential ascending triangle pattern, with the flat resistance line and rising support. This formation often suggests accumulation and could hint at a possible breakout if volume increases meaningfully. Momentum indicators are currently in neutral territory, with the RSI hovering in the mid-40s to low 50s range, reflecting a lack of strong directional bias. Trading volume has been relatively steady, though below the average seen during previous upward moves. A sustained push above the $720.95 resistance would likely require a noticeable pickup in volume, while a break below $652.29 could signal a shift in short-term sentiment. Traders may watch for a decisive move beyond these levels to gauge the next directional bias. Outlook

Looking ahead, IES Holdings faces a pivotal technical juncture. The stock recently tested the $652.29 support level, finding enough buying interest to bounce toward the $686.62 area. A sustained hold above this zone could open the path toward the $720.95 resistance, a level that has capped upside momentum in recent weeks. Conversely, a breakdown below support might invite further selling pressure, with the next floor potentially forming at lower demand levels. Fundamental catalysts continue to revolve around infrastructure modernization and data center buildouts, segments where IES’s electrical and communications services have gained traction. The broader economic backdrop—including interest rate expectations and nonresidential construction spending—will likely influence the pace of project awards. Management’s commentary on backlog trends and labor availability could provide additional color on near-term execution. Traders should watch volume patterns near key thresholds; a decisive move through resistance on above-average turnover would signal conviction, while a low-volume rally might prove fragile. Earnings season updates from peers in the electrical contracting space may also shift sentiment. As always, no single factor guarantees direction—the interplay between technical levels, macroeconomic data, and company-specific fundamentals will shape the stock’s trajectory in the weeks ahead.
